NFPA 30 focuses on hazards created by flammable and combustible liquids, including fire growth potential, heat exposure to nearby structures, and the consequences of vapor release during storage or handling. Section 13.2 ties those hazards to the concept of separation. Where buildings or portions of buildings are detached or effectively isolated, NFPA 30 expects the fire safety approach to shift to reflect that separation.

For facility owners and safety managers, the key operational takeaway is that detachment does not mean exemption. It means the code evaluates how separation changes fire exposure pathways, protective features, and how quickly fire detection and suppression must perform to protect people, protect property, and contain fire impact.

NFPA 30 Section 13.2 applicability detached buildings is typically addressed during code analysis for projects that include separated structures such as:

  • Detached storage buildings for drums, totes, or small tanks
  • Separate pump rooms, meter rooms, or transfer sheds
  • Detached flammable liquid processing or blending areas
  • Detached waste handling and container storage areas

Applicability depends on the facility’s separation characteristics and how the detached structure relates to the overall flammable liquids system. During plan review or internal hazard assessment, teams normally confirm alignment with the code definitions and the separation intent. Common compliance pitfalls include:

  • Assuming “distance equals detachment” without documenting how the separation affects the risk scenario
  • Failing to integrate shared hazards such as common piping corridors, hose use routes, or transfer bay traffic
  • Underestimating the impact of wind driven fire spread, radiant heat, or exposure through openings and vents
  • Not matching the fire protection design basis to the actual operating procedures, including start up, shutdown, and spill response

Once the detached building pathway applies, NFPA 30 expects the facility fire safety program to reflect a consistent risk model. This often changes practical decisions in the field, especially for inspection, impairment management, and maintenance. Below are the operational areas most frequently affected.

Detached buildings frequently rely on engineered detection strategies that must maintain effectiveness for the actual release scenarios in that space. The compliance challenge comes from mismatch between installation assumptions and real conditions such as:

  • Seasonal ventilation changes that alter vapor accumulation
  • Temporary storage changes that increase combustibles near protected equipment
  • Inaccurate calibration intervals for gas detection when used near flammable liquid vapors

Facility teams should verify that alarm response procedures for detached structures are reflected in training, emergency communication plans, and contractor access controls.

Detached structures still require reliable suppression and exposure protection as determined by the applicable sections of NFPA 30. Maintenance frequently drives compliance outcomes here. Common failure points include blocked nozzles, corrosion on piping, impaired detection caused by dust and overspray, and incomplete functional testing after repairs.

Commercial facilities should schedule inspections to verify that the protection system matches the latest layout, container usage pattern, and operational workflow. If the detached building has changes such as relocated drums, revised transfer lines, or added process equipment, the protection design basis may need revalidation.

Detached does not isolate liquid behavior. Spills can move through drainage paths, surface grading, and hose management practices. Maintenance requirements commonly include:

  • Functional checks on sumps, drains, and shutoff devices tied to flammable liquid drainage control
  • Verification that containment barriers and curbs remain unobstructed
  • Housekeeping standards that prevent combustible accumulation and reduce vapor ignition risk

Where the code expects protection consistent with detached risk, facilities must also document that spill response equipment is compatible with the liquids stored and that response times are achievable with site resources.

Detached buildings often include transfer piping runs and hoses that connect systems. Failure modes occur when operational changes affect those routes, including added transfer points, revised hose lengths, or temporary bypasses during maintenance. A strong compliance program includes:

  • Impairment controls that prevent use of transfer equipment with compromised valves, seals, or monitoring
  • Clear isolation steps when shutting down transfer operations
  • Procedure audits that confirm staff follow the intended sequence for leak checks and securing equipment

This is where many facilities experience audit findings. The code evaluation may be correct on paper, but operational drift over time undermines compliance.

Facilities that store flammable liquids in or near detached buildings should treat NFPA 30 Section 13.2 as a trigger for a broader compliance workflow. A practical approach includes:

  1. Perform a documented code applicability assessment for each detached structure, including layout, separation characteristics, and intended operations.
  2. Confirm consistency between design and operations, especially for transfer frequency, container types, and ventilation behavior.
  3. Align inspection and maintenance plans to detached building risk, including functional tests, cleaning requirements, and corrosion control.
  4. Train staff and contractors on detached building response actions, including who initiates notifications and how equipment is secured.
  5. Track impairment history and verify that corrective actions restore system performance, not just “routine repairs.”

Audit outcomes often hinge on evidence quality and operational control. The most frequent issues include:

  • Missing the applicability analysis for each detached building, leaving inspectors to infer assumptions without documentation
  • Using outdated site plans that do not match current storage locations or transfer equipment placement
  • Inspection records that do not verify functional performance, such as tests completed but not tied to risk conditions in the detached structure
  • Gaps in contractor procedures, particularly during hot work, tank or pump maintenance, or changes to hose and valve configurations
  • Delayed corrective actions after findings, leading to prolonged impairment and increased exposure to vapor and fire scenarios
